Output 17052d2d86eee5c7a29673f8dbbbcc7654309286ddca4e0f5eee2ae3c6676920:1

value
5869660
script pubkey
OP_0 OP_PUSHBYTES_20 97b8503e2a80769a779a465b1c9fa705fbba50d7
address
ltc1qj7u9q032spmf5au6ged3e8a8qham55xhx80mgq
transaction
17052d2d86eee5c7a29673f8dbbbcc7654309286ddca4e0f5eee2ae3c6676920
spent
true